Output 66cc91ab52643557b0991179376def8e8489d2f582c72fe58eae7fc073b0778b:44

value
5843
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2b0542adad3f7d51dc71c8a697e75ea17988d82393fdfb4d4185922f42a77c21
address
bc1p9vz59tdd8a74rhr3eznf0e6759uc3kprj07lkn2pskfz7s480sssjxksu8
transaction
66cc91ab52643557b0991179376def8e8489d2f582c72fe58eae7fc073b0778b
spent
true